FHE: Prayer

Don't forget to check out this and enter. :)
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Sing: "I Pray in Faith"
Opening Prayer:

Teach 4 Fingered Approach to Prayer. (Hold up a finger for each number or Print out the words big on paper)
1. Dear Heavenly Father
2. We thank thee...
3. We ask thee...
4. In the Name of Jesus Christ Amen.

Share the Story of Enos using the Gospel Art Kit


Object Lesson: Have the kids sit on the floor beside their dad.
Ask: how do you know your dad is here? (You can see him, touch him, hear and talk to him)
Blind fold the kids.
Ask: how do you know your dad is here? Can you see him? Can you touch him? Can you hear and talk to him?
This is like our Heavenly Father. Just because we can't see Him, doesn't mean He isn't close and listening to us. We have to listen more and talk more. And feel the Holy Ghost near to feel His Spirit.

Bear testimony.
Sing song again.
Closing Prayer.
